The Economist of Nature

Indian-British economist Sir Partha Dasgupta received an Honorary Doctorate at Péter Pázmány Catholic University. At the request of the British government, Professor Sir Partha Dasgupta prepared the widely cited report, The Economics of Biodiversity in 2019, which was published in 2021. Elisabeth Haub Award 2026: The Call for Nominations Has Started

The Elisabeth Haub Award for Environmental Law and Diplomacy is the world’s most prestigious award in the field of environmental law, recognizing the innovation, skill, and accomplishments of lawyers, diplomats, and international civil servants.
